A Military is the most vital asset for any country where manpower is considered as most effective resource. The success of a military operation depends on deliberate planning, secure and uninterrupted communication, and conservation of manpower till the last. The aim of this paper is to develop an efficient system for operation commander to deploy or positioning the soldiers and to aware the status (dead or alive) of soldiers during a military operation. The system is equipped with bomb detection; once the presence of bomb/Metal is detected it beeps the sound and alerts the soldiers. To attain this objective, here firstly a conceptual framework is proposed to develop a system named Bharat Dal Suraksha. Secondly the conceptual framework is implemented comprising both the hardware and software parts. Finally, an evaluation study was conducted to assess the usability and effectiveness of the proposed Bharat Dal Suraksha system with 4 participants (military personnel). The Bharat Dal Suraksha system assist for accurate deployment of the troops during operation, help to observe and guide movement of own troops, keep aware about the soldier’s status (dead or alive). The evaluation study found that the Bharat Dal Suraksha system performs with high accuracy, while test-participants opined that the Bharat Dal Suraksha is a usable, useful, and efficient system.
